History of Schlossplatz

Schlossplatz, a historic square in Dresden, is a testament to the city's rich cultural heritage and tumultuous past. The square, which translates to "Castle Square," is situated adjacent to the Residenzschloss, or Royal Palace, and has served as a central hub since the Renaissance period.

The area saw significant development during the reign of Augustus the Strong in the 18th century, who aimed to transform Dresden into a cultural and architectural marvel. Unfortunately, much of Schlossplatz was reduced to ruins during the devastating bombings of World War II.

Post-war reconstruction efforts have meticulously restored many of its iconic structures, including the Semperoper and Katholische Hofkirche, to their former glory. Today, Schlossplatz stands as a vibrant gathering place, surrounded by museums, cafes, and historic landmarks, offering visitors a glimpse into Dresden's storied past.

Unique features of Schlossplatz

Schlossplatz in Dresden is renowned for its remarkable blend of architectural styles, reflecting the city's rich cultural tapestry. One of the most striking features is the Residenzschloss, or Royal Palace, which dominates the square with its intricate Renaissance and Baroque design. This historic building is home to the Green Vault, a world-famous museum housing a stunning collection of treasures, including the Dresden Green Diamond.

The square is also distinguished by its artistic installations and sculptures. Notably, the equestrian statue of King John of Saxony stands as a centerpiece, symbolizing the monarch's significant contributions to the city's development. The combination of these artistic elements with the surrounding historic architecture creates an open-air gallery atmosphere.

Schlossplatz offers a unique vantage point for panoramic views of the adjacent Elbe River and the majestic Augustus Bridge. This picturesque setting is complemented by the meticulously maintained gardens and fountains that provide a serene escape amidst the bustling city. The square's strategic location makes it a gateway to other notable sites, including the Semper Opera House and the Zwinger Palace, further enhancing its allure as a cultural and historical hub.

Interesting facts about Schlossplatz

Schlossplatz in Dresden is home to the Fürstenzug, the largest porcelain artwork in the world, depicting a grand procession of Saxon rulers. Another fascinating feature is the 'Green Vault' (Grünes Gewölbe), which holds one of Europe's most opulent treasure collections, with some pieces dating back to the 16th century. The square also features a statue of King John of Saxony, who was not only a monarch but also a scholar, known for translating Dante's 'Divine Comedy' into German. Additionally, the square is a popular spot for open-air concerts and cultural events, blending the historic ambiance with contemporary arts. During the reconstruction after World War II, Schlossplatz became a symbol of Dresden's resilience and cultural revival.

Best time to visit Schlossplatz

The best time to explore Schlossplatz in Dresden, Germany, is during the late spring (May to June) and early autumn (September to October) months. During these periods, the weather is typically mild and pleasant, making it ideal for leisurely walks and enjoying the architectural splendor of the square. These seasons also see fewer tourists compared to the peak summer months, allowing for a more relaxed and intimate experience.

In May and June, the blooming flowers and greenery around Schlossplatz add an extra layer of beauty to the already stunning surroundings. The Dresden Music Festival, held in May and June, often features open-air concerts that can be enjoyed from the square, enhancing the cultural experience.

September and October bring a crispness to the air and vibrant autumn foliage, creating a picturesque backdrop for photography. Additionally, the reduced crowd levels during these months make it easier to explore the nearby attractions such as the Royal Palace and the Zwinger Palace without long waits.

For those who love festive atmospheres, December is also a magical time to visit Schlossplatz. The annual Striezelmarkt, one of Germany's oldest Christmas markets, fills the air with the scent of mulled wine and gingerbread, making it a unique and enchanting time to explore Schlossplatz.
